文件名称:SDL_bgi:兼容 BGI、基于 SDL2 的“GRAPHICS.H”实现-开源
文件大小:2.24MB
文件格式:ZIP
更新时间:2024-06-19 03:16:48
开源软件
SDL_bgi 是一个基于 SDL2 的 Borland 图形接口 (GRAPHICS.H) 仿真库。 这个库严格模拟了几乎所有的 BGI 功能,使得编译为 Turbo/Borland C 编写的程序的 SDL 版本成为可能。还实现了 ARGB 扩展和基本的鼠标支持; 此外,SDL_bgi 程序中可以使用本机 SDL2 函数。
【文件预览】:
SDL_bgi-2.4.4
----BUGS(503B)
----src()
--------graphics.h(268B)
--------lcom.h(121KB)
--------Makefile(2KB)
--------trip.h(154KB)
--------tscr.h(162KB)
--------euro.h(86KB)
--------Makefile.CodeBlocks(1KB)
--------font.h(55B)
--------Makefile.DevCpp(898B)
--------sans.h(134KB)
--------litt.h(60KB)
--------SDL_bgi.h(13KB)
--------goth.h(173KB)
--------SDL_bgi.c(130KB)
--------bold.h(154KB)
--------simp.h(89KB)
--------scri.h(117KB)
----bin()
--------CodeBlocks()
--------Mingw64()
--------Dev-Cpp()
----TODO(71B)
----LICENSE(900B)
----doc()
--------turtlegraphics.pdf(128KB)
--------howto_CodeBlocks.pdf(130KB)
--------sdl_bgi-quickref.pdf(245KB)
--------howto_howto_Dev-Cpp.pdf(133KB)
--------howto_CodeBlocks.md(3KB)
--------fonts.md(781B)
--------SDL_bgi_logo.png(45KB)
--------functions.md(6KB)
--------howto_Dev-Cpp.pdf(133KB)
--------graphics.3.gz(8KB)
--------using.pdf(167KB)
--------functions.pdf(97KB)
--------howto_Dev-Cpp.md(3KB)
--------SDL_bgi_logo.svg(25KB)
--------p2man.sh(150B)
--------compatibility.md(5KB)
--------compatibility.pdf(149KB)
--------turtlegraphics.tex(5KB)
--------sdl_bgi-quickref.tex(58KB)
--------using.md(14KB)
--------graphics.3.md(26KB)
--------fonts.pdf(74KB)
----ChangeLog(7KB)
----README.md(2KB)
----VERSION(6B)
----INSTALL_Windows.md(4KB)
----INSTALL_macOS.md(1KB)
----build.sh(972B)
----tmp()
--------dumpchar.c(962B)
--------bgi_palette.png(16KB)
--------chr_decoder.c(9KB)
--------README.md(468B)
--------truncate.c(989B)
----sdl_bgi.spec(2KB)
----AUTHORS(192B)
----test()
--------f90_test.f90(2KB)
--------conio.h(455B)
--------Makefile(3KB)
--------boo.c(2KB)
--------multiwin.c(3KB)
--------sdlbgidemo.c(30KB)
--------mandelbrot.c(7KB)
--------kaleido.c(4KB)
--------plasma.bmp(1.03MB)
--------turtledemo.c(7KB)
--------fonts.c(6KB)
--------psychedelia.c(3KB)
--------mousetest.c(2KB)
--------setpalette.c(2KB)
--------README.md(6KB)
--------hopalong.c(2KB)
--------turtle.c(16KB)
--------plasma.c(2KB)
--------buffers.c(2KB)
--------logo.bmp(765KB)
--------fern.c(3KB)
--------dla.c(4KB)
--------life.c(3KB)
--------cellular.c(3KB)
--------simple.c(3KB)
--------floodfilltest.c(2KB)
--------dos.h(831B)
--------linebuffers.c(2KB)
--------turtle.h(4KB)
----CMakeLists.txt(4KB)
----INSTALL_Linux.md(2KB)